Output 667b0b4c81f5c9ebd89dfb00e2a7e40427fab980157e69ec65ca8e6f13e16d80:2

value
1008536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89b61fb51428026ace9ce993f6b0794543c9d0ae OP_EQUAL
address
3EFAg1eQ8WMZQ8DtsUH5JYmM3BRvWYUBDE
transaction
667b0b4c81f5c9ebd89dfb00e2a7e40427fab980157e69ec65ca8e6f13e16d80
spent
true